Born 10 January 1965, Pretoria, South Africa
Matriculated 1982, Afrikaans Girls’ High School, Pretoria, South Africa
Qualifications: Certificate in Tourism, Technicon, Pretoria, South Africa
BA (Fine Arts), University of Pretoria, 1987
Honores History of Art, University of Pretoria 1992, MA (Fine Arts,) University of Pretoria 1994
